The red wine Roero Riserva d'Ampsèj DOCG, vintage 2016 from the winery Matteo Correggia has been rated in 2020 by Othmar Kiem, Simon Staffler with 93 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Nebbiolo from the region Piedmont in Italy.

Tasting Notes

93
Tasting from 22.10.2020: Othmar Kiem, Simon Staffler

Dark shining ruby red. Open, inviting nose of rich red cherries, raspberries, dark leather, undergrowth and tea. An expressive palate with great tension and salty core, compact fruit, hearty tannins with a long and harmonious finish.
